Comunicação, o termo central do título deste trabalho, pretende realmente ser uma espécie de pivô da articulação que queremos aqui estabelecer entre as ciências sociais e a saúde. Por um lado, a sua emergência como um campo de questões diferenciadas, com objetos e olhares relativamente novos, no seio do pensamento social já desde fins do século 18, passando pelas suas primeiras elaborações teóricas e estudos empíricos, já no quadro das ciências sociais, desde meados do século 19, depois pela sua diferenciação como um campo disciplinar em separado, em meados do século 20, até se tornar um verdadeiro emblema das sociedades contemporâneas, neste limiar do século 21. Por outro lado, as relações entre o que preferimos genericamente chamar de pensamento sobre a comunicação, rastreado no percurso histórico acima, e o campo da saúde, no seu mais amplo sentido. Assim, propomo-nos, primeiramente, a reconstituir a emergência e as evoluções desse pensamento sobre a comunicação nos últimos dois ou três séculos, destacando o seu profundo enraizamento nas ciências sociais, e, secundariamente, apontar as relações privilegiadas e variáveis ao longo da história entre esse pensamento e o conhecimento e a prática em saúde.

This article introduces the software program called EthoSeq, which is designed to extract probabilistic behavioral sequences (tree-generated sequences, or TGSs) from observational data and to prepare a TGS-species matrix for phylogenetic analysis. The program uses Graph Theory algorithms to automatically detect behavioral patterns within the observational sessions. It includes filtering tools to adjust the search procedure to user-specified statistical needs. Preliminary analyses of data sets, such as grooming sequences in birds and foraging tactics in spiders, uncover a large number of TGSs which together yield single phylogenetic trees. An example of the use of the program is our analysis of felid grooming sequences, in which we have obtained 1,386 felid grooming TGSs for seven species, resulting in a single phylogeny. These results show that behavior is definitely useful in phylogenetic analysis. EthoSeq simplifies and automates such analyses, uncovers much of the hidden patterns of long behavioral sequences, and prepares this data for further analysis with standard phylogenetic programs. We hope it will encourage many empirical studies on the evolution of behavior.

This article examines the interplay between legitimacy and context as key determinants of public sector reform outcomes. Despite the importance of variables Such as legitimacy of public institutions, levels of civic morality and socio-economic realities, reform strategies often fail to take such contextual factors into account. The article examines, first, relevant literature both conceptual and empirical, including data from the World Values Survey project. It is argued that developing countries have distinctive characteristics which require particular reform strategies. The data analysed shows that in Latin American countries, there is no clear Correlation between confidence in public institutions and civic morality. Other empirical studies show that unemployment has a negative impact on the level of civic morality, while inequality engenders corruption. This suggests that poorer and socio-economically stratified countries face greater reform challenges owing to the lack of legitimacy of public institutions. The article concludes that reforms should focus on areas of governance that impact on poverty. This will in turn help produce more stable outcomes. Copyright (C) 2008 John Wiley & Sons, Ltd.

Background: Functional redundancy has been debated largely in ecology and conservation, yet we lack detailed empirical studies on the roles of functionally similar species in ecosystem function. Large bodied frugivores may disperse similar plant species and have strong impact on plant recruitment in tropical forests. The two largest frugivores in the neotropics, tapirs (Tapirus terrestris) and muriquis (Brachyteles arachnoides) are potential candidates for functional redundancy on seed dispersal effectiveness. Here we provide a comparison of the quantitative, qualitative and spatial effects on seed dispersal by these megafrugivores in a continuous Brazilian Atlantic forest. Methodology/Principal Findings: We found a low overlap of plant species dispersed by both muriquis and tapirs. A group of 35 muriquis occupied an area of 850 ha and dispersed 5 times more plant species, and 13 times more seeds than 22 tapirs living in the same area. Muriquis dispersed 2.4 times more seeds in any random position than tapirs. This can be explained mainly because seed deposition by muriquis leaves less empty space than tapirs. However, tapirs are able to disperse larger seeds than muriquis and move them into sites not reached by primates, such as large forest gaps, open areas and fragments nearby. Based on published information we found 302 plant species that are dispersed by at least one of these megafrugivores in the Brazilian Atlantic forest. Conclusions/Significance: Our study showed that both megafrugivores play complementary rather than redundant roles as seed dispersers. Although tapirs disperse fewer seeds and species than muriquis, they disperse larger-seeded species and in places not used by primates. The selective extinction of these megafrugivores will change the spatial seed rain they generate and may have negative effects on the recruitment of several plant species, particularly those with large seeds that have muriquis and tapirs as the last living seed dispersers. © 2013 Bueno et al.
